物联网平台提供商如何助力传统家居厂商提供智慧家庭解决方案

传统家居产品厂商包括灯具厂、开关、插座、报警器、门锁生产厂商,没有足够的技术积累进行独立的物联网软硬件开发,但是又想进入智能家居领域。这个时候就期望能够借力具有实力的物联网平台提供商提供完善的平台进行支撑。

智能家居基本组成有,具有通信模组的设备端下位机,云服务器,手机app。相应的物联网平台提供商要提供通信模组(含协议栈和控制逻辑固件)、云服务器和手机app。

如果家居厂商完全不具备软硬件开发能力,智能控制需求也比较常规。可以使用如下方案:

采购物联网平台提供商的通信模组(含协议栈和控制逻辑固件)。物联网平台企业提供硬件对接文档。其中描述了模组引脚的含义。家居厂商只需要按文档进行对接即可实现设备端的智能化。比如灯具、开关、插座、报警器。

使用物联网平台企业提供的中性化的APP。厂商也可以自己客制化更改APP名字、图标、启动页面、关于页面内容。使用物联网平台企业提供的云服务器。

如果家居厂商有一些个性化的智能控制功能,而且具有一定的软硬件开发能力,可以使用如下方案:

采购物联网平台提供商的通信模组(模组只提供通信功能)。除了按照硬件对接文档进行对接外。相关的固件代码由家居厂商自己开发。比如门锁。

自己开发APP。这个时候物联网平台提供商提供如下服务:

提供APP开发的SDK。对常用流程进行封装,提供API(当然包含各种自定义的数据结构)。比如:提供局域网扫描设备发现功能。提供事件响应回调接口。提供下行机控制查询接口。比如:LED灯的接口,可以开关和调色。家居厂商以此为基础开发移动客户端软件。比如andriod中,只需要将物联网平台企业提供的.so文件和jar文件copy至andriod工程的libs目录下即可。

对于非常用的流程,需要家居厂商自行封装。物联网平台提供商会提供如下两项内容:

设备指令集。以key-value对的方式展示。

云服务器的API接口标准。例如:包括HTTP API(短连接)、WebSocket API(长连接,适用于第三方云的连接)。所有的数据都使用JSON格式描述。提供的接口有用户管理、用户设备绑定、设备查询、控制、分组、消息通知、保活消息、历史报表等。对接时采用HTTPS。用户登录时要提供第三方APP ID(提前申请)和用户名、密码。用户登录后得到Client ID和AccessToken,供后续流程使用。基于RESTful架构设计。比如HTTP基本格式为http://domain/API_version/object-type/object

家居厂商根据设备指令集和云服务器的API接口标准封装相关操作。开发APP。

云服务器仍然由物联网平台企业提供。

通过使用物联网平台提供商的模组和平台,大大降低了家居厂商将产品智能化的门槛。物联网平台提供商专注物联网功能,家居厂商继续专注家具产品本身。两者在各自擅长的领域深耕,通过合作给用户提供完整智能家居服务,实现物联网平台提供商和家居产商的合作共赢。

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值